Output 04eefbb1000b06ddb5d62ad628b74e594d2fa9373aa7e556a5fb62ac2624fde1:0

value
2815643
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7dd7da634f1e64e0427a2354c6b35fc55ba8e8dd OP_EQUAL
address
3DAQyFsvGaAPxtkTfYcrfMTkvHvdifyuXv
transaction
04eefbb1000b06ddb5d62ad628b74e594d2fa9373aa7e556a5fb62ac2624fde1
confirmations
532323
spent
true